Beep, beep, beep...

Toji Fushiguro walked along the stone path outside the Tombs of the Star Corridor, his phone vibrating incessantly in his pocket.

"Yeah?"

The familiar cold voice came through the line. "The Star Plasma Vessel? Dealt with?"

"She got away."

"What?"

The voice suddenly turned furious. "Zen... Toji Fushiguro! We agreed on assassinating the Star Plasma Vessel. If you haven't done it, we're not paying!"

"Yeah~ yeah~"

Toji rolled his eyes. "The Six Eyes Twins and Cursed Spirit Manipulation are already handled. The Star Plasma Vessel is just a matter of time."

"Anyway, your Star Religious Group's goal is to stop Tengen from merging with the Star Plasma Vessel. She's not in the Tombs of the Star Corridor right now, so waiting a bit longer won't be a problem."

"Then you'd better hurry. Remember, if we don't see the Star Plasma Vessel's corpse, we're not paying... Hey! Hey! Toji Fushiguro, are you listening?"

Toji stared blankly at the figure before him, momentarily forgetting to reply to the call.

"Hey! Toji Fushiguro! Can you hear me? Hey!"

Toji snapped his phone shut and shoved it into his pocket, staring in disbelief at the person in front of him.

Gojo Satoru!

Under the glaring sunlight, his figure looked somewhat thin, white hair still stained with flecks of red.

Gojo Satoru lifted his head, his clothes covered in bloodstains, yet his disheveled face bore a smile he'd never shown before.

"Hey! Long time no see!"

Toji's pupils contracted sharply, his expression one of unprecedented shock.

"You've got to be kidding me?"

"Of course I'm serious!"

Gojo Satoru reached up and brushed aside the bangs on his forehead, revealing the already healed wound. "I'm alive and kicking!"

Toji furrowed his brow.

Resurrection from the dead—such an eerie sight could only mean...

"Reverse Cursed Technique?"

"Bingo!"

Gojo Satoru spread his arms wide, looking like an elementary schooler delighted at having guessed the answer correctly.

"Tch!"

Toji pulled out the Inverted Spear of Heaven, assuming a combat stance with a sneer. "Looks like the real fight's just starting now!"

"No, the outcome is already decided!"

A familiar voice came from behind him.

Toji turned around as if seeing a ghost, only to find Gojo Sawa, drenched in blood, slowly stepping forward with a manic grin on his face.

"Thanks a lot, Toji!"

Gojo Satoru caught sight of Gojo Sawa and smiled knowingly.

"Just as I thought, brother—there's no reason I could do it and you couldn't!"

"Thanks to me?"

Toji was somewhat baffled.

Gojo Sawa explained, "That's right. Before this, no matter what, we couldn't learn Reverse Cursed Technique!"

"Turns out, only by tasting the flavor of death and clinging to life with a near-perverse desperation can you unlock the key to Reverse Cursed Technique!"

"Negative cursed energy multiplied by negative cursed energy equals positive cursed energy! Ah~ Toji, you really should have cut off our heads—then victory would have been yours!"

At that moment, Gojo Sawa wore the same exaggerated expression as Gojo Satoru.

"Only by approaching death infinitely can you awaken the truth of life. I told you that myself, Sawa!"

The sudden voice stunned the three of them.

They saw Suguru Geto slowly walking out from within the Tombs of the Star Corridor.

With every step, the terrifying amount of cursed energy, nearly overflowing, made the surrounding air twist slightly.

Suguru Geto looked at Toji Fushiguro and laughed, patting his chest. "That slash really hurt, you know!"

Toji was completely dumbfounded.

What the hell? One after another, they're all using me as a stepping stone?

Gojo Sawa and Gojo Satoru looked at Suguru Geto, and he looked back at them.

The three of them exchanged knowing smiles.

Gojo Sawa hadn't expected that his casual words would lead Suguru Geto to comprehend Reverse Cursed Technique as well.

"Reverse Cursed Technique is still a cursed technique—I'll just shove the Inverted Spear of Heaven into your heads and be done with it!"

Toji Fushiguro laughed angrily, connecting the Inverted Spear of Heaven to the Ten Thousand Mile Chain as his figure vanished in an instant.

Clang!!!

A sharp blade flashed past, and Toji Fushiguro's eyes froze.

"Phase."

"Paramita."

"Pillar of Light."

"Cursed Technique Reversal: Red!"

Gojo Sawa's voice rang out behind him.

The forward rotation of the Limitless technique produced a powerful attraction, while its reversal was repulsion!

Toji Fushiguro had barely turned his head when a black-red sphere slammed into him, carrying an overwhelming repulsive force.

Boom!!!

The ground-level structures of the Tombs of the Star Corridor were smashed to pieces—this strike was like a giant plowing the earth.

The violent assault left Toji Fushiguro dizzy, and before he could steady himself, Gojo Satoru appeared before him.

"My turn. Cursed Technique Reversal: Red!"

"Again?"

Toji Fushiguro hurriedly raised the Inverted Spear of Heaven to block.

The Inverted Spear of Heaven had the ability to nullify cursed techniques, so it could be used as a technique shield like this.

But even though the spear successfully dispelled Red, the terrifying repulsive force still sent his body flying.

"Pfft~"

Toji Fushiguro spat out a mouthful of blood, staggering to his feet, only to see Suguru Geto walking toward him.

Geto smiled amiably. "Don't worry, my technique isn't as rough as theirs."

"All Void."

"All Bhikkhus."

"Malaka."

"Cursed Technique Reversal: Bestow."

As the words fell, a Rainbow Dragon roared forward.

Seeing this, Toji Fushiguro grinned. "I've already killed one of those before. Bringing it back won't work on me!"

Geto said nothing, just watched him with a smile.

Without a word, Toji Fushiguro drew the Soul Liberation Blade and dispatched this grade-1 cursed spirit in two strikes.

But before he could catch his breath, three Rainbow Dragons charged out from behind Geto.

Toji Fushiguro paused for a moment, but taking down three Rainbow Dragons didn't seem like much of a challenge.

Just as he thought that, the shadows behind Geto turned into a bottomless black hole, and one Rainbow Dragon after another poured out in a steady stream.

"What the hell?"

By the time Toji Fushiguro realized what was happening, he was already surrounded by a dense swarm of Rainbow Dragons!

Even if he could easily take down one Rainbow Dragon, or even ten, it wouldn't be a problem.

But here, there were no less than a hundred!

And Rainbow Dragons weren't exactly common cabbage—they were among the strongest grade-1 cursed spirits.

Toji Fushiguro was dumbfounded. "This... this is Cursed Spirit Manipulation?"

Geto explained with a smile. "It's the reversal of Cursed Spirit Manipulation."

"The principle behind Cursed Spirit Manipulation's subjugation is to convert cursed spirits into their original form of cursed energy for storage, then release them during battle."

"Converting cursed spirits into cursed energy—that's the forward rotation of Cursed Spirit Manipulation. I call it 'Subdue.'"

"And its reversal is converting cursed energy back into cursed spirits. Oh, no, that's not quite right—cursed spirits are originally born from cursed energy, so it's more like a catalyst that accelerates that process!"

As he spoke, Geto waved his hand, and dozens of Slit-Mouthed Women—the ones Toji Fushiguro had just killed—appeared at once!

"Now my cursed energy is nearly limitless, so I can create an infinite number of cursed spirits."

"So... how long can you hold out?"

With those words, countless cursed spirits roared toward Toji Fushiguro, beginning a righteous gang beatdown.

Toji Fushiguro fought against the horde while observing Gojo Sawa, Gojo Satoru, and Suguru Geto.

But what struck him as strange was that the three of them—Gojo Sawa, Gojo Satoru, and Suguru Geto—floated into the air as lightly as feathers.

Sunlight spilled over them, casting long silhouettes.

"This feeling... it's so strange!"

"Like a fish drifting with the current in the sea?"

"Ah! This world makes me feel utterly exhilarated!"

The three of them floated unsteadily in the air, then, as if by unspoken agreement, struck the same pose—one hand pointing to the sky, the other to the ground.

Afterward, almost instinctively, they spoke in unison: "Above and below the heavens, I alone am the honored one!"

As the words fell, they stared at each other.

"Hey! That was my line, wasn't it!"

"Shut up, Jie, you said it with zero presence!"

"However you look at it, you two were imitating me, right?!"

"Such a domineering line—you two perverts shouldn't even be reciting it!"
